How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Oradell?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Oradell Studio Apartments | $1,640 | $1,640 | $1,640 |
Oradell 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,403 | $1,650 | $3,785 |
Oradell 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,151 | $2,000 | $6,200 |
Oradell 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,250 | $4,250 | $4,250 |
Oradell 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,200 | $4,200 | $4,200 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Oradell
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Oradell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Oradell ranges from $1,650 to $3,785 with an average monthly rent of $2,403.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Oradell c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Oradell range from $2,000 to $6,200.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,151.
